ADANI GREEN : US DOJ DEFENDS DROPPING CRIMINAL CASE 🟢🟢
• 🏛️ US Department of Justice defended its decision to drop criminal charges against Gautam Adani and seven others
• 📑 DoJ cited legal and pragmatic reasons, including possible diplomatic concerns and lack of a strong US legal basis
• 💰 Said there were no victims who suffered losses and no restitution could be recovered, weakening the case
• ⚖️ Argued the matter was primarily a foreign issue and there was insufficient basis to continue US criminal prosecution
• 📌 Filing came after a US judge sought a detailed explanation for the government's move to permanently dismiss the indictment
🟢 Impact: Positive (Reduces a major legal overhang for the Adani Group and improves investor sentiment.)

🏍️ *Hero MotoCorp* reports *June 2026* sales.
📊 *Total dispatches:* *5.41 lakh* units *(down 2.3% YoY)*, below estimates of *5.55 lakh* units.
🏍️ *Motorcycle dispatches:* *4,78,701* units *(down 6.6% YoY)*.
🛵 *Scooter dispatches:* *62,458* units *(up 51.2% YoY)*.
🇮🇳 *Domestic dispatches:* *5,02,890* units *(down 4.2% YoY)*.
🌍 *Exports:* *38,269* units *(up 32.8% YoY)*.
📈 *YTD FY27 dispatches:* *16,77,313* units *(up 22.7% YoY)*.
